While the pirates were busy expanding their influence, the Navy was simultaneously resisting the tide and rebuilding its strength.Between the World Military Draft and the relocation of Marine Headquarters, the most significant matter remained the selection of the new Fleet Admiral. Shortly after the Summit War ended, Sengoku had submitted his resignation, intending to step down and have Admiral Aokiji succeed him.

Upon receiving this news, the higher-ups were extremely reluctant to follow Sengoku’s recommendation. Like Sengoku, Kuzan was a moderate "Dove" who favored a more relaxed style of justice. The World Government much preferred a hardline "Hawk" to occupy the position of Fleet Admiral.

Unfortunately, Sakazuki, the Admiral candidate once favored by the Government for his iron-fisted resolve, had been eliminated by Alucard and was now a core combatant for the enemy.

Turning to the other two Admirals: Fujitora harbored a deep loathing for the Government, making his appointment impossible. As for Borsalino, his lackadaisical temperament spoke for itself.

Looking further down the ranks, there were plenty of "Hawkish" Vice Admirals, with the likes of Onigumo and his peers being prime examples. However, they simply lacked the necessary raw power.

For a time, the Government was paralyzed by indecision. They were also still deliberating on how to handle the massive hole Alucard had blasted directly beneath Mariejois.

Meanwhile, Kuzan, the protagonist of this administrative crisis, had been summoned to the Fleet Admiral’s office by Sengoku for a lecture.

"The higher-ups aren’t keen on you taking the mantle, but you are effectively the only choice. There is a better than 50% chance you will be appointed. You must be prepared to take office at a moment’s notice."

Sengoku spoke with earnest concern, but Kuzan stood opposite him looking utterly disinterested, yawning occasionally. This finally caused Sengoku to lose his temper. He slammed his desk and roared, "You brat! Are you even listening to me? As the next Fleet Admiral, you have to fix that attitude of yours!"

Kuzan lifted his heavy eyelids. "About that... strictly speaking, wouldn’t Fujitora be a better fit? I... well..."

"Fujitora is out of the question," Sengoku stated firmly.

It was common knowledge within the Navy that Fujitora despised the Government. He had snubbed them on multiple occasions; one didn’t need to be a genius to know the higher-ups would never agree to him.

Realizing he had no way out, Kuzan scratched his head. "How about this? Let me head out and travel for a while to observe the current state of the seas. That should be fine, right?"

Sengoku knew Kuzan was just stalling for time, but on second thought, the matter wasn’t that urgent. Besides, while he was getting old, he wasn’t dead yet; staying in the seat for a bit longer wouldn’t hurt. He nodded. "Fine. The Navy is currently preoccupied with the relocation of the Headquarters and the World Military Draft. The Government is also plagued by headaches regarding the new Seven Warlords of the Sea and that tunnel at the bottom of Mariejois. Your succession doesn’t have to happen this second."

Sengoku paused to consider, then said, "I’ll give you three months."

"Make it a year?" Kuzan blinked.

"Four months." Sengoku’s eyelid twitched.

"Nine months," Kuzan bargained.

"Six months..." Sengoku hissed through gritted teeth, looking like he was about to go berserk.

"Deal!"

Kuzan clapped his hands and nodded instantly. Sengoku realized he had been played by this slippery fellow, his eyes bulging with murderous intent.

"Fleet Admiral Sengoku!"

Suddenly, an urgent shout came from a soldier outside. "The Immortal Pirates are showing signs of large-scale movement!"

Inside, both Kuzan and Sengoku were taken aback.

They had only received news two days ago that the Immortal Pirates had conquered and occupied Wano. What could they be up to so soon?

Sengoku ordered the man in. A Major hurried inside, saluting both Sengoku and Kuzan before reporting: "Latest intelligence just arrived! The Immortal Pirates are deploying in groups from the New World toward the first half of the Grand Line, as well as the West, North, and South Blues! The specific objective is unknown, but a massive amount of armed force is being mobilized. Captain Alucard’s personal movements are still being investigated."

"Are they trying to seize territory from Kaido and the others?"

Sengoku stroked his braided beard, theorizing, but he quickly dismissed the thought. If that were the case, they would be operating in the New World. Why head to the first half of the Grand Line and the four Blues?

"Investigate immediately! The Immortal Pirates are at the height of their influence right now; there’s no telling what they’re capable of," Sengoku ordered sternly.

"Yes, sir!" The Major saluted and backed out of the office.

Kuzan, who had remained silent since the report began, finally spoke up. "Well, it looks like the first stop of my journey has been decided."
